About

Exe Valley ward is located in East Devon, covering a mix of rural villages and farmland. The area is named after the River Exe, which flows through the region, shaping its landscape. Villages like Brampford Speke, Nether Exe, and Rewe are part of the ward, featuring traditional thatched cottages and historic churches. The surrounding countryside is characterised by rolling hills, woodland, and fields used for agriculture.

The ward has a strong community focus, with local events often held in village halls or churches. Public transport links are limited, with most residents relying on cars for travel. The River Exe provides opportunities for fishing and walking, while nearby Exeter offers urban amenities. The area maintains a quiet, rural atmosphere, with a mix of older residents and families drawn to its countryside setting.

Area overview

On average Exe Valley has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 34 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 7.3%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Exe Valley is £54,100 per year. There are 2 schools in Exe Valley: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good).
